iTherm
®
280 Programmer’s Guide Programming Codes
28-07764 Rev C Page 179
[ENQ] <23> Inquire user-store status
ASCII [ENQ] <23>
Hexadecimal 05H 17H
Decimal <5> <23>
Function The [ENQ] <23> command reports on the user-store status.
Response [ACK] <23> <Report> <0>
Where <23> is the echo of command ID. The report is a null terminated string with the
following format:
12345[CR][LF] (Free user store)
12345 Type Name…[CR][LF] (First entry) etc.
12345 Type Name…[CR][LF] (Last entry) <0>
Type The type field describes the type of information.
M = macro
C = character definition
[ENQ] <24> Inquire Color status
ASCII [ENQ] <24>
Hexadecimal 05H 18H
Decimal <5> <24>
Function The [ENQ] <24> command reports Color Cartridge status.
Response [ACK] <24> <Length+40><n
1
><n
2
><n
3
>
Where <24> Is the echo of command
<n
1
> Secondary Paper Color 0 = Not installed, 1 = Red, 2 = Green, 4 = Blue
<n
2
> Primary Paper Color 1 = Red, 2 = Green, 4 = Blue 16 = Black
<n
3
> Pen Status
bit 0 = Not defined
bit 1 = Not defined
bit 2 = Secondary Cartridge not installed
bit 3 = Primary Cartridge not installed
bit 4 = Secondary Cartridge low on ink.
bit 5 = Primary Cartridge low on ink.
bit 6 = 1 always
bit 7 = 0 always
[ESC] [EM]P<n> Activate Periodic Status Back
ASCII [ESC] [EM] P<n>
Hexadecimal 1BH 19H 50H <n>
Decimal <27> <25> <80><n>
IPCL None
EPOS None
Description This command activates the periodic status back feature. It will
automatically return an [ENQ]<20> status (See page Error! Bookmark